当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器验证警告是什么意思,服务器验证警告的深度解析,从原理到解决方案的完整指南

服务器验证警告是什么意思,服务器验证警告的深度解析,从原理到解决方案的完整指南

服务器验证警告是HTTPS通信中因证书或安全策略异常触发的安全提示,常见于浏览器或客户端,其核心原理在于SSL/TLS协议要求客户端与服务器验证证书有效性及安全策略合规...

服务器验证警告是HTTPS通信中因证书或安全策略异常触发的安全提示,常见于浏览器或客户端,其核心原理在于SSL/TLS协议要求客户端与服务器验证证书有效性及安全策略合规性,主要诱因包括:1)证书过期或CA链断裂;2)服务器配置错误(如未启用TLS 1.2+);3)安全策略(Security Policy)与实际内容冲突;4)中间人攻击或证书被吊销,解决方案需分三步实施:基础排查(检查证书有效期、验证证书链完整性);配置优化(升级TLS版本、禁用弱密码套件、调整HSTS策略);高级防护(部署证书自动化续订、启用OCSP stapling、配置安全策略严格模式),企业级应用建议结合证书监控工具与Web应用防火墙进行持续防护,确保全链路安全可信。

(全文约1580字)

服务器验证警告的本质解析 1.1 技术背景与核心概念 服务器验证警告是网络通信安全机制的重要体现,本质上是SSL/TLS协议框架下的身份认证过程,当客户端(如浏览器、移动应用)与服务器建立连接时,会触发双向验证机制:

服务器验证警告是什么意思,服务器验证警告的深度解析,从原理到解决方案的完整指南

图片来源于网络,如有侵权联系删除

  • 服务器验证:客户端验证服务器证书的有效性
  • 客户端验证:服务器验证客户端的身份(常见于API认证场景)

2 协议工作流程 以HTTPS连接为例,验证过程包含以下关键步骤:

  1. 客户端向服务器发送ClientHello消息
  2. 服务器返回ServerHello及包含证书链的ServerKeyExchange
  3. 客户端验证证书有效期(距当前时间超过90天视为过期)
  4. 验证证书颁发机构(CA)是否在受信任根证书集中
  5. 验证证书域名与实际访问域名是否匹配(SNI检查)
  6. 验证证书签名算法是否被禁用(如SHA-1)

3 常见触发场景

  • 浏览器访问网站时弹窗警告
  • 移动APP连接企业内网时提示
  • REST API调用返回401/403状态码
  • VPN客户端建立连接失败
  • 电子支付系统身份验证中断

服务器验证警告的典型成因分析 2.1 证书配置错误(占比约62%)

  • 自签名证书:未通过CA机构签发的证书(如测试环境自建证书)
  • 证书过期:有效期不足90天(浏览器严格检查)
  • 中间证书缺失:证书链不完整(如缺少根证书)
  • 域名不匹配:证书主体域名与实际访问域名不一致(如*.example.com vs www.example.org)
  • IP地址绑定错误:证书中的IP地址与服务器实际IP不符

2 安全策略冲突(占比约18%)

  • HSTS策略冲突:服务器启用HSTS但证书未包含该域名
  • CAA记录冲突:DNS中的CAA记录限制证书颁发机构
  • OCSP响应问题:证书验证过程中OCSP服务器不可用
  • 客户端安全设置:设备安全策略禁止弱加密算法

3 网络环境干扰(占比约15%)

  • 代理服务器配置不当:透明代理未正确转发证书
  • VPN隧道问题:加密隧道导致证书链中断
  • DNS污染攻击:伪造的DNS响应导致证书验证失败
  • 网络防火墙拦截:安全设备错误拦截SSL流量

4 证书颁发机构限制(占比约5%)

  • 高风险国家CA限制:部分国家CA机构证书被浏览器禁用
  • 企业级证书限制:免费证书(如Let's Encrypt)存在使用限制
  • 证书黑名单:被标记为证书颁发方存在安全风险的机构

系统化解决方案 3.1 证书生命周期管理

  • 自动续订系统:设置证书提前30天触发续订流程
  • 证书库存管理:使用Certbot等工具批量管理200+证书
  • 敏感信息保护:通过ACME协议的DNS-01挑战实现密钥托管

2 网络基础设施优化

  • 代理服务器配置:配置Nginx作为反向代理处理SSL卸载
  • 网络分段策略:划分DMZ区与内网隔离
  • 零信任网络架构:实施持续身份验证机制

3 安全策略协同

  • HSTS策略实施:设置max-age=31536000(1年)并包含子域名
  • CAA记录配置:在DNS设置caa=example.com CA=Let's Encrypt
  • OCSP响应缓存:配置OCSP stapling功能(Nginx+Let's Encrypt)

4 客户端适配方案

  • 浏览器兼容性处理:针对IE11的TPM2.0兼容模式
  • 移动端优化:Android 10+的TSL 1.3强制启用策略
  • API客户端配置:使用OpenSSL库的证书缓存功能

高级防护体系构建 4.1 多因素认证增强

服务器验证警告是什么意思,服务器验证警告的深度解析,从原理到解决方案的完整指南

图片来源于网络,如有侵权联系删除

  • 证书指纹绑定:在服务器配置文件中记录证书哈希值
  • 动态证书更新:结合Kubernetes实现证书自动旋转
  • 生物特征认证:在移动端集成指纹/面部识别验证

2 威胁检测响应

  • 证书吊销监控:实时检测CRL/OCSP状态
  • 防篡改检测:使用Integrity Hash验证证书内容
  • 网络流量分析:通过NetFlow识别异常SSL流量

3 审计与合规

  • 证书审计日志:记录每次证书访问与操作
  • 合规性检查:符合PCI DSS第4.1.1条要求
  • 第三方认证:通过SSLCAM证书认证体系

典型案例深度剖析 5.1 金融支付系统验证失败事件 某银行APP在2023年Q2遭遇大规模验证警告,经排查发现:

  • 证书有效期仅45天(未达浏览器90天要求)
  • 证书颁发机构为自建根CA
  • 未启用OCSP stapling功能 解决方案:
  1. 部署ACME协议实现自动续订
  2. 申请DigiCert企业级证书
  3. 配置Nginx实现OCSP stapling
  4. 建立证书生命周期管理系统

2 跨国企业内网接入问题 某跨国公司内网接入时出现持续验证警告,根本原因:

  • 证书包含内网IP地址(违反PKI安全策略)
  • VPN设备未安装根证书
  • DNS记录未正确配置 改进措施:
  1. 使用IP-SAN证书替代内网IP证书
  2. 部署企业级证书管理系统
  3. 配置Cisco ASA实施证书白名单

未来发展趋势 6.1 量子安全准备

  • 后量子密码算法研究:NIST正在标准化的CRYSTALS-Kyber算法
  • 证书迁移计划:预计2025年后逐步淘汰RSA-2048

2 AI赋能的自动化管理

  • 证书智能推荐:根据业务负载自动选择证书类型
  • 风险预测模型:基于历史数据预测证书失效概率
  • 自愈证书系统:自动检测并修复证书配置错误

3 零信任架构演进

  • 证书即身份:将证书作为设备身份凭证
  • 动态证书颁发:基于设备指纹的临时证书
  • 上下文感知验证:结合地理位置、设备类型等多因素

总结与建议 服务器验证警告本质是网络安全的必要验证环节,处理不当将导致业务中断,建议企业建立:

  1. 证书全生命周期管理系统(包括申请、签发、存储、吊销)
  2. 多层防御体系(网络层+应用层+终端层)
  3. 自动化响应机制(CI/CD集成证书更新)
  4. 持续安全评估(每季度进行证书审计)

对于开发人员,建议:

  • 使用Let's Encrypt实现免费证书自动化管理
  • 在CI/CD流程中集成证书验证测试
  • 遵循OWASP SSL/TLS指南
  • 定期更新安全策略(参考NIST SP 800-52)

随着网络攻击手段的升级,建议将证书管理纳入企业安全架构顶层设计,通过技术手段与流程优化相结合,构建真正的纵深防御体系。

黑狐家游戏

发表评论

最新文章